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_032141.4(NSRP1):c.10C>T(p.Pro4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000133 in 1,575,946 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P4R) has been classified as Uncertain significance.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Nov 30, 2021 | The c.10C>T (p.P4S) alteration is located in exon 1 (coding exon 1) of the NSRP1 gene. This alteration results from a C to T substitution at nucleotide position 10, causing the proline (P) at amino acid position 4 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
